What is Restavit and its Chemical Identity?

Restavit is a specific brand name for a medication whose sole active ingredient is Doxylamine Succinate, a synthetic compound. The chemical identity of Doxylamine Succinate classifies it as a First-generation Histamine H1 Receptor Antagonist. This designation indicates that the substance works by competitively inhibiting the binding of histamine at the H1 receptors located in the body and the brain. Doxylamine's molecular structure allows it to easily cross the blood-brain barrier, a key feature for its direct influence on the central nervous system.

Doxylamine Succinate: Composition and Physical Form

Doxylamine Succinate is classified as a sedating H1 antagonist. The core component responsible for the drug’s action is the Doxylamine base, which is paired with the Succinate salt form to create Doxylamine Succinate, enhancing its stability for formulation and optimizing absorption after ingestion. As a single active ingredient product, Restavit is typically manufactured as an oral tablet, a fixed-dose form used for short-term management of occasional sleeping difficulties in adults. The medication is designed solely for oral administration, allowing the active component to be absorbed via the gastrointestinal tract.

What side effects are possible with Restavit?

Possible Side Effects and Safety Information

The safety profile of Doxylamine Succinate (Restavit) is structured by governmental regulatory authorities based on adverse reaction frequency, the system-organ classes affected, and specific limitations.

Classification of Adverse Reactions

The most frequently documented adverse reaction is somnolence (drowsiness), which is classified as Very Common (occurring in 1/10 or more users). This effect is utilized for the medicine's primary purpose. Other effects, typically related to the medication’s anticholinergic properties, are generally classified as Common (occurring in 1/100 to less than 1/10 users). These include dry mouth, constipation, blurred vision, dizziness, and headache.

Post-marketing reports also list events such as confusion, vertigo, palpitations, and urinary retention, where the frequency is often categorized as Not Known.

System-Organ Class Common Adverse Reactions
Nervous System Drowsiness, Dizziness, Headache
Gastrointestinal Dry mouth, Constipation
Eye Disorders Blurred vision

Serious Safety Considerations

Official labeling documents specific constraints and serious safety concerns. Severe CNS depression is a risk, particularly when Doxylamine Succinate is used concurrently with alcohol or other Central Nervous System (CNS) depressants. This combination is strongly restricted due to the potential for excessive additive sedation.

Specific population-based cautions are noted for older adults, who have an increased susceptibility to adverse anticholinergic effects like confusion and urinary retention. Caution is also advised in individuals with renal or hepatic impairment due to the potential for altered clearance and increased exposure.

Overdose and Emergency Response

Overdose and when to seek help: Restavit (Doxylamine)

Overdosing on Restavit (doxylamine succinate) requires immediate medical attention and is considered a serious medical emergency due to the risk of severe complications. Even if there are no immediate signs of discomfort or poisoning, contact for urgent medical help is required immediately upon suspected overdose.

Restavit overdose primarily presents as signs of anticholinergic toxicity. Initial presentations may include symptoms such as extreme drowsiness, dry mouth, blurred vision, flushing, nervousness, irritability, and hallucinations. These can rapidly progress to more severe and potentially fatal outcomes.

Severe Overdose Manifestations

System Symptoms
Central Nervous System (CNS) Impaired consciousness, delirium, seizures, coma
Cardiovascular Tachycardia, cardiorespiratory arrest, cardiovascular collapse
Other Systems Respiratory failure, rhabdomyolysis (muscle breakdown) with acute kidney impairment

Children are considered particularly vulnerable to cardiorespiratory arrest in overdose situations. Emergency management in a healthcare setting includes close monitoring of vital signs, assessment of breathing and blood pressure, and providing full supportive care. Measures to prevent further drug absorption, such as gastric lavage or activated charcoal administration, may be considered if performed soon after ingestion. Always seek professional emergency assistance immediately.

Eligibility and Restrictions for Use

Restavit (Doxylamine Succinate) is officially intended for use by adults for the short-term management of occasional sleeplessness. Eligibility is strictly defined by regulatory documents, which establish specific criteria for who must not use the medicine.


Non-Eligible and Restricted Populations

Category Eligibility Status
Absolute Contraindications Contraindicated in patients with hypersensitivity to the drug or other similar antihistamines, and those currently taking Monoamine Oxidase Inhibitors (MAOIs). Use is also prohibited in patients with conditions aggravated by anticholinergic effects, such as narrow-angle glaucoma or pyloroduodenal obstruction and conditions predisposing to urinary retention.
Age and Development Contraindicated or Not Recommended in children and adolescents under 12 or 18 years of age (depending on regulatory region). Caution is required for use in the elderly due to increased susceptibility to effects.
Organ Function/Status Use requires caution in patients with hepatic (liver) or severe renal (kidney) impairment. The medicine is not recommended for use during pregnancy or while breastfeeding.

Official eligibility documentation establishes that use is strictly limited to the adult population without these specific contraindicating conditions or physiological states.

What should I know about interactions with other medicines?

The official regulatory classification for Doxylamine Succinate identifies several categories of pharmacodynamic interactions and a formal contraindication.

Contraindicated Combinations and Restrictions

The most stringent regulatory restriction is the contraindication of co-administration with Monoamine Oxidase Inhibitors (MAOIs), or agents possessing MAOI activity (e.g., linezolid or procarbazine). This restriction is due to the potential to prolong and intensify the anticholinergic and Central Nervous System (CNS) depressant effects of doxylamine. This classification establishes a mandatory 14-day separation period between discontinuing MAOI therapy and beginning treatment with doxylamine.

Pharmacodynamic Synergism and Additive Effects

The concurrent use of Doxylamine Succinate with alcohol (ethanol) or other CNS depressants (including hypnotic sedatives, narcotic analgesics, and anxiolytics) is officially not recommended. This combination is documented to result in an additive depressant effect, leading to severe drowsiness.

Other documented interactions include the potentiation of adverse effects when combined with agents that have anticholinergic properties. Furthermore, caution is advised with drugs known to prolong the QT interval or those that cause electrolyte disturbances, which may increase the risk of cardiac rhythm changes.

Precautionary avoidance of potent CYP enzyme inhibitors is also noted in regulatory documents, based on the known metabolism of Doxylamine. Caution is also noted for use in patients with hepatic or renal impairment, as reduced clearance may modify the overall interaction profile.

The regulatory documents establish the product's interaction structure primarily around pharmacodynamic synergism that mandates the prohibition of use with MAOIs and the avoidance of other CNS depressants.

Mechanism of Action

Restavit's mechanism of action is defined by its interaction with key neurotransmitter systems in the central nervous system ( CNS). Its function is to modulate signaling in the histaminergic pathway, which is associated with wakefulness.


Modulating Arousal Signals via Central Histamine H1 Blockade

The primary mechanism involves the competitive antagonism of Histamine H1 Receptors within the brain. The molecule's high lipophilicity allows it to easily penetrate the blood-brain barrier, where it suppresses the histaminergic pathway—a major component of the Ascending Reticular Activating System (ARAS). Interrupting this core wakefulness cascade causes a reduction in overall neuronal excitability and leads to a physiological state of Central Nervous System ( CNS) depression.


Secondary Influence on Cholinergic Signaling Pathways

In addition to its primary target, the drug engages a secondary mechanistic domain through antagonism of Muscarinic Acetylcholine Receptors ( M-AChR). This non-selective action modulates cholinergic signaling, influencing pathways related to arousal and various involuntary autonomic functions. This dual action results in a physiological effect profile that includes consequences beyond the singular H1 blockade.

Dosage and Administration Information

How to Use Restavit: Official Administration Guidelines

Restavit (Doxylamine Succinate) is a single-ingredient product administered exclusively via the oral route for short-term use. The official instructions define the dosage, timing, and population-specific rules for standardized administration.


Administration Parameter Official Labeled Instruction
Standard Adult Dose 25 mg for adults and adolescents aged 12 years and over.
Frequency and Timing Once daily, taken approximately 20 to 30 minutes prior to the intended time of sleep onset.
Administration Condition Should be swallowed with a glass of water. May be administered without regard to meals.
Duration of Use Intended strictly for short-term or occasional use.

Population-Specific and Procedural Instructions

The medication is not intended for use in pediatric patients younger than 12 years of age. For older adults or individuals with impaired hepatic (liver) or renal (kidney) function, a dosage reduction—often to 12.5 mg—may be warranted to mitigate sensitivity. This lower dose is facilitated by a break bar on the 25 mg tablet, allowing for accurate dose halving. The overall administration protocol establishes a clear, time-bound regimen that must not exceed the once-daily frequency.

Recent Clinical Evidence

Research Evidence / Overview of Studies for Restavit (Doxylamine)


Evidence for Use in Short-Term Sleeplessness

Research examining Doxylamine for temporary difficulty falling asleep includes Randomized Controlled Trials (RCTs) and larger scale systematic reviews. These studies are applied in research exploring how sleep patterns change over short periods, typically comparing the medication to a placebo (a dummy pill). Studies explored outcomes related to patient-reported outcomes describing perceived discomfort and monitoring the functional imbalance of sleeplessness. These factors included the time patients took to fall asleep (sleep latency) and the recorded length of time they remained asleep (total sleep time).

Studies monitored patterns related to sleep onset, where the time measured to fall asleep was observed to be shorter in the groups receiving the medication compared with the control groups. Research describes patterns where total sleep duration was observed to be longer in the groups receiving the medication. However, the evidence is relevant in trials assessing short-term or episodic symptom patterns, meaning the findings describe patterns observed only over limited time intervals, such as a single night or up to four weeks.


Evidence for Mild Allergy and Cold Symptom Research

Doxylamine was studied for its application in conditions characterized by fluctuating or episodic manifestations, such as those associated with mild allergies or the common cold. The research base here relates to the drug’s classification as a First-Generation H1 Antihistamine. Studies examined specific outcomes linked to inflammatory or irritative states, such as monitoring the frequency of sneezing and subjective reports of a runny nose (rhinorrhea).

Findings describe patterns observed in the studies where the medication was associated with changes measured in outcomes related to physical discomfort. Research describes patterns where studies reported specific changes in symptom intensity during the monitored periods. However, findings were mixed when the research attempted to evaluate the overall symptom intensity for the common cold.


Long-Term Data and Durability of Effect

The research exploring short-term symptom changes provides limited information for long-term outcomes related to Doxylamine use. The vast majority of the evidence is derived from settings with varying symptom burdens over defined time intervals that rarely exceed four weeks. Research indicates that the body may develop tolerance to the medication's effects, meaning the observed patterns may lessen after just a few days of repeated use. As a result, the long-term effects are not fully established, and evidence for chronic or ongoing sleep disorders is considered insufficient.

Frequently Asked Questions (FAQ)

Common questions about Restavit (FAQ)


Q: Is it safe to take Restavit with common pain relievers like paracetamol or ibuprofen?

Official information on drug interactions does not specifically cite a direct drug-to-drug interaction between doxylamine (the active ingredient in Restavit) and common pain relievers like paracetamol (acetaminophen) or ibuprofen. However, regulatory warnings describe the need for caution when combining medications.

For any medication combination, the product information outlines the importance of following the recommended maximum daily dose for each product to avoid accidental overdose.


Q: What is the recommended maximum duration of use?

Regulatory documents emphasize that Restavit is intended for short-term or occasional use only in managing temporary sleeplessness. Official labeling may indicate that consulting a healthcare provider is suggested if sleeplessness continues for longer than a few days or one to two weeks, depending on the region's specific guidance. This guidance is provided as the medication is intended only for temporary, occasional sleeplessness.


Q: Is there any risk of developing tolerance or dependence on Restavit?

Official product information notes that using the medication for long periods is generally not recommended due to the possibility of developing tolerance, meaning the effect may lessen over time with repeated use. Although the active ingredient is not classified as a controlled substance, the official recommendation to limit use to the short-term is intended to mitigate the risk of reliance on the medication for sleep.


Q: Are there known interactions between Restavit and herbal supplements like valerian or kava?

The active ingredient in Restavit works by causing central nervous system (CNS) depression, which means it slows down activity in the brain. Regulatory warnings indicate that the medicine may potentiate the effects of other substances that also cause central nervous system (CNS) depression, including some herbal supplements. For this reason, official sources describe that concurrent use with any other sedatives or CNS depressants should be avoided.

How should Restavit be stored and disposed of?

How to Store and Dispose of Restavit?

The storage and disposal of Restavit (Doxylamine Succinate) tablets must strictly follow the official instructions provided on the regulatory label to maintain product stability and ensure safety.

Storage Requirements

  • Temperature and Environment: The medicine must be stored below 30 C in a dry place. Users must not store the tablets in environments prone to heat and moisture, such as bathrooms, or expose the product to freezing temperatures.
  • Packaging and Stability: Tablets must be kept in the original container with the lid tightly closed and must not be used past the printed expiry date.
  • Child Safety: It is a mandatory requirement to keep the product out of the sight and reach of children.

️ Disposal Instructions

To dispose of unused or expired Restavit, follow official pharmaceutical waste guidelines. Do not discard the medicine in domestic garbage bins or flush it down the toilet. The recommended procedure is to return the unwanted tablets to a local community pharmacy for proper and safe disposal.
